Ingredients

  • ½ cup uncooked long-grain white rice
  • 3 potatoes, sliced
  • 1 onion, sliced into rings
  • 2 carrots, cut into 1 inch pieces
  • 1 (15 ounce) can green peas, with liquid
  • 1 (10.75 ounce) can condensed tomato soup
  • 1 (10.75 ounce) can water
  • 1 pound pork sausage, sliced and browned
  • salt and pepper to taste

Information

  • Prep Time: 10 mins
  • Cook Time: 45 mins
  • Total Time: 55 mins
  • Servings: 5
  • Yield: 4 to 6 servings

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• In a lightly greased 9x13 inch baking dish layer the rice, potatoes, onion, carrots, peas, tomato soup with water, and sausage. Salt and pepper to taste.
  • Bake covered at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 45 minutes, or until fork tender. Remove cover for last 5 minutes of baking.
